Short version: every tool on this site runs entirely in your browser. Your files are never uploaded, transmitted to, or stored on any server we operate. We have no way to see the contents of what you process here.

What we don't collect

We do not operate a backend for file processing. There is no upload endpoint. PDFs you open in any tool on this site are read, processed, and (where applicable) downloaded again entirely within your browser tab. We never receive a copy of your files, their contents, or any data extracted from them.

We do not require an account, and we do not ask for your name, email address, or any other personal information to use any tool on this site.

What is stored locally on your device

The only thing this site saves is a single preference: whether you've chosen dark or light theme, stored in your browser's localStorage. This value never leaves your device and is not transmitted to us or anyone else. We do not use tracking cookies, analytics scripts, or fingerprinting of any kind.

Third-party infrastructure

Loading this site involves a small number of third parties whose standard technical logs are outside our control:

  • Hosting provider. This site is served as static files via Cloudflare Workers. Like essentially every web host, Cloudflare keeps ordinary server access logs (IP address, requested path, timestamp, user agent). This is standard web infrastructure logging, not something specific to this site, and we do not use it to identify you or your activity. See Cloudflare's privacy policy.
  • jsDelivr (CDN). The open-source libraries each tool depends on (pdf.js, Tesseract.js, pdf-lib) are fetched from jsDelivr's public CDN. Your browser makes a direct request to jsDelivr for those files, subject to jsDelivr's own privacy practices, not ours. See jsDelivr's privacy policy. We verify the integrity of what jsDelivr returns with a cryptographic hash before executing it, but we don't control what jsDelivr itself logs about the request.

Neither of the above involves your file contents. They relate only to the loading of the page and its code, not to anything you subsequently do with a PDF in your browser.
